Here’s the installation shot of my concrete experiment currently on show at BAT Pack, a group show at Mile End Art Pavilion. Really happy with how it turned out, and am thinking of ways to get commissions using the technique.
There were lots of issues to get to this point printing in my darkroom, mostly involving the size and weight of the concrete slab. I ended up borrowing 3 wheelie bin lids from the estate to submerge the slab in chemicals..not recommended but it worked! The final piece went through 13 different processes which I worked out through many late night tests, ouch…
60cm x 60cm. Treated concrete, liquid emulsion hand print.
